The above two patents are for my Vehicular Heatstroke Prevention System

(VHPS)

Tragically, there have been over 906 reported U.S. child vehicular heatstroke deaths since 1998. My invention can stop these deaths.

  • My invention, the VHPS, can detect the presense of a child:
    • If the temperature rises to a preset threshold, the VHPS starts the vehicle's engine and air conditioning unit preventing any heatstroke to the child.
    • An Android app I wrote automatically contacts emergency personnel, providing GPS coordinates, directions and real-time information.

This publication is for research I performed at Harvard Univeristy.

  • Soft robots have a variety of innovative use applications:
    • Surgery
    • Rescure operations on uneven terrain
    • Rehabilitation
    • Biomimicry
  • A fluidic control system allows fluidic control of soft robots
  • Soft robots use multiple inputs to perform intricate actions, such as flexible gripping or manipulating another object. We developed a more efficient design utilizing one individual input to perform multiple intricate movements. Fewer robotic parts can provide the same complex information to the robot while minimizing weight and creating a simpler user interface.
